Q: Why does Routewise sometimes assign the second-closest driver?

A: The heuristic weights idle time, not just distance — a driver parked for 40 minutes beats one 200m closer. It's intentional; keeps churn down. If you need to force pure-distance mode for a demo, flip the override flag in the dispatch console. The console unlocks with the passphrase below.

vault phrase of bagaf-kajeg = jorath-feniel-briir-siliel-ralix

We will add strict schema validation at the renderer boundary, reject layouts exceeding defined geometry bounds, and log rejected payloads for audit. Owner: rendering team; target: next sprint. The validation spec, rejected-payload handling rules, and audit log format are detailed on the page below.

dashboard of tawef-hagug = https://superset.norvadyn.local/display/projects/build/ticket/build/spaces/ticket/1e989f0e6c200d20fc4ae06b

Plugins for the Dunloe platform can subscribe to our read-replica lag alarm. When replica lag on the Ashwick cluster exceeds the configured threshold, your plugin's hook fires with the lag value in milliseconds. To receive these events locally, your plugin needs the alarm bus credential. Add the following line to your plugin's env file:

secret setting of bagep-bagaf: RELAY_SECRET20=d023966b74a2783c8ab5

Minutes — Management Meeting, Orvale Systems

Attendees reviewed churn in the Harbline pilot programme. Of 42 pilot customers, nine lapsed in the quarter, concentrated among smaller accounts onboarded without training. Ms. Tevrel presented exit-survey findings citing setup friction and unclear billing. Actions agreed: revised onboarding checklist, dedicated pilot support rota, and monthly retention reporting to the incoming director. The following note summarises the confidential plan under discussion.

internal memo for kawip-hadug: Headcount on the Wenwyn team goes from 7 to 140 by the end of January. Gross margin on Wenwyn came in at 20 percent against a plan of 15 percent.